Beach Safety Tips for Families: Sunscreen Reapplication and Jellyfish Encounters Spending time at the beach with children is a cherished summer activity, but it's crucial to prioritize safety. A recent video shared online highlights two simple yet effective methods to ensure a worry-free beach day. The video's creator, a mother from Florida, emphasizes the importance of diligent sunscreen use. "I reapply every 50 minutes when using SPF 50," she states, acknowledging the intense Florida sun. This highlights the critical need for frequent reapplication, especially after swimming or sweating. Beyond sunscreen, the video demonstrates an innovative approach to dealing with jellyfish.
